Hello, and welcome to the Stray Lantern on-call rotation. If a plugin author reports missing translations, the usual cause is the extraction script skipping strings wrapped in custom helpers. Ask for their manifest and rerun extraction with verbose logging before escalating. The full diagnostic procedure for plugin authors is on the page below.

operations page: https://confluence.qorvellabs.internal/pages/projects/projects/projects

Confirm MARC-variant records with diacritics round-trip correctly and that duplicate accession merging preserves the older acquisition date. Imports over 50,000 records must complete within the 40-minute window; anything slower indicates the indexer batching regression has returned. Sign-off requires two consecutive clean runs, not one. After the second clean run, record the promoted artifact here so downstream branches can pin against it.

session token of hawif-bajog = htk6_9ab8da

**Ticket: Payroll export vault locked ahead of format change**

The Marrowgate payroll team is switching the export from fixed-width to the new columnar format in the next release. While staging the converter, the export-secrets vault auto-locked after the schema validator rejected two test runs. Release manager: please note the vault must be manually unsealed before cutting the release candidate, or the converter will silently fall back to the old format. Unseal the vault with the passphrase below.

unlock words, hahip-baduf: holwyn-istath-julvan

Build provenance — Nimblecheck baseline. Quick reminder for the sync: the static-analysis baseline file (lint-baseline.toml) is generated, not hand-edited. If your branch shows hundreds of new findings, you probably regenerated it against the wrong commit. Regen only from main, and attach the producing build so we can audit provenance. The canonical build token follows below.

trace token, fafog-kageg: htk4_98e6